Though he has retired from the spotlight and decided to focus on shaping up his rap record label Katt Pack Records, trouble still has found a way to reach beloved comedian Katt Williams. Apparently, the comedian was arrested for burglary and criminal trespassing just outside of Atlanta, Georgia overnight.
A deputy has confirmed that the comedian still remains in custody as of this morning. Other than that, details regarding the incident are being kept tightly under wraps. This comes about one year after Katt's last run in with the law. Last year in New York City prior to doing a show, Katt was pulled over for driving a car with no license plates. When his vehicle was searched, the cops also found a gun and arrested Katt and his crew. The charges against him were ultimately dropped due to the inability to prove things beyond a reasonable doubt. Around this same time, Katt also went through the infamous mental break down incident due to exhaustion. At the end of all of that, he went on to announce his retirement from doing stand up comedy. Katt is scheduled for an arraignment today, at which time a court official is expected to set a bond amount for the comedian's release. When more details become available, I'll return with an update.
